Unlocked 3GS "No Service" at random
iPhone 3GS
iOS 4.0
Baseband 05.11.07
Jailbroken with PwnageTool 4.01
Unlocked with ultrasn0w 0.93
Purchased with contract from AT&T, now being used with Vodafone in Italy
For about a week now, my phone will mysteriously and at random drop into "Searching..." for an extended period of time until finally changing to "No Service". This does not depend on location, as it happens anywhere I go, nor time, as it happens at all hours. It does seem, strangely, to be time-based, that is, if I let it sit for 20-30 minutes the signal will eventually come back. Oddly, if I remove the SIM card at this time, it will sometimes even remain at "Searching..." or "No Service", without changing to "No SIM" (though not always). This leads me to believe it is hardware-related, also because I have been using the phone unlocked for about a year now and installed iOS 4 about a month ago, but only recently started seeing this issue. Scouring the internet, I have found and attempted all of the following remedies, all without success:
Toggle Airplane Mode
Disable 3G
Remove SIM card and re-seat
Turn on Airplane Mode, remove SIM card, replace SIM card
Reboot phone (Soft and Hard)
Reset Network Settings
Reset All Settings
Erase All Content and Settings
Restore OS from backup (this I tried many times)
Restore OS as a new phone
Downgrade to iOS 3.1.3
Install BossPrefs before unlock (3.1.3)
Tape SIM card to SIM tray
Holding phone in every way imaginable
etc...
Oh yes, I've tried multiple SIM cards (AT&T as well as other carriers) in the phone with the same result. And I've placed my SIM into another iPhone and it worked perfectly.

Reload the baseband to a higher version (3.1.3 or 4.0 - ultrasn0w supports both) and test again.
Otherwise - it is likely hardware.

Yep. Friend of mine had this exact behavior on his iPhone 4, turned out to be a bad SIM slot. If the baseband upgrade doesn't work, you may need to have a hardware swap done.
